首页  软件  游戏  图书  电影  电视剧

请输入您要查询的图书:

 

图书 数据库设计与关系理论(影印版)
内容
编辑推荐

戴特(Data,C.J.)所著的《数据库设计与关系理论(影印版)》回答了如下问题:为什么Heath定理如此重要?什么是正交设计原则为什么有些联合检测可以规约而另一些不行?依赖保持性有什么作用?需要总是避免数据冗余吗?可能吗?本书为你展示了如何使用重要的理论知识来创建良好的数据库设计。

内容推荐

是什么让这本书从数据库设计的相关书籍中脱颖而出?很多讨论设计实践的书籍很少讲解内在理论知识,而讨论设计理论的书籍却又主要针对理论工作者。在戴特(Data,C.J.)所著的《数据库设计与关系理论(影印版)》中,著名专家C.J.Date以从业者可以理解的方式来讲解设计理论,弥补了前述的不足。该书以作者四十多年的经验教训总结而成,阐述了为什么恰当的设计在初始阶段如此重要。

《数据库设计与关系理论(影印版)》的每一章都包含一组练习,它或者展示了如何把理论知识应用到实践中,或者提供了更多的信息,或者要求你验证一些简单的理论结果。如果你非常熟悉数据库的关系模式,并且你希望深入了解数据库设计,那么这本书就完全适合你。

目录

Preface

PART I SETTING THE SCENE

Chapter 1 Preliminaries

 Some quotes from the literature

 A note on terminology

 The running example

 Keys

 The place of design theory

 Aims of this book

 Concluding remarks

 Exercises

Chapter 2 Prerequisites

 Overview

 Relations and relvars

 Predicates and propositions

 More on suppliers and parts

 Exercises

PART II FUNCTIONAL DEPENDENCIES, BOYCE/CODD NORMAL FORM,

 AND RELATED MATTERS

Chapter 3 Normalization: Some Generalities

 Normalization serves two purposes

 Update anomalies

 The normal form hierarchy

 Normalization and constraints

 Concluding remarks

 Exercises

Chapter 4 FDs and BCNF (Informal)

 First normal form

 Functional dependencies

 Keys rex, isited

 Second normal form

 Third normal form

 Boyce/Codd normal form

 Exercises

Chapter 5 FDs and BCNF (Formal)

 Preliminary definitions

 Functional dependencies

 Boyce/Codd normal form

 Heath's Theorem

 Exercises

Chapter 6 Preserving FDs

 An unfortunate conflict

 Another example

 ... And another

 ... And still another

 A procedure that works

 Identity decompositions

 More on the conflict

 Independent projections

 Exercises

Chapter 7 FD Axiomatization

 Armstrong's axioms

 Additional rules

 Proving the additional rules

 Another kind of closure

 Exercises

Chapter 8 Denormalization

 "Denormalize for performance"?

 What does denormalization mean?

 What denormalization isn't (I)

 What denormalization isn't (II)

 Denormalization considered harmful (I)

 Denormalization considered harmful (II)

 A final remark

 Exercises

PART III JOIN DEPENDENCIES, FIFTH NORMAL FORM,

 AND RELATED MATTERS

Chapter 9 JDs and 5NF (Informal)

 Join dependencies--the basic idea

 A relvar in BCNF and not 5NF

 Cyclic rules

 Concluding remarks

 Exercises

Chapter 10 JDs and 5NF (Formal)

 Join dependencies

 Fifth normal form

 JDs implied by keys

 A useful theorem

 FDs aren't JDs

 Update anomalies revisited

 Exercises

Chapter 11 Implicit Dependencies

 Irrelevant components

 Combining components

 Irreducible JDs

 Summary so far

 The chase algorithm

 Concluding remarks

 Exercises

Chapter 12 MVDs and 4NF

 An introductory example

 Multivalued dependencies (informal)

 Multivalued dependencies (formal)

 Fourth normal form

 Axiomatization

 Embedded dependencies

 Exercises

Chapter 13 Additional Normal Forms

 Equality dependencies

 Sixth normal form

 Superkey normal form

 Redundancy free normal form

 Domain-key normal form

 Concluding remarks

 Exercises

PART IV ORTHOGONALITY

Chapter 14 The Principle of Orthogonal Design

 Two cheers for normalization

 A motivating example

 A simpler example

 Tuples vs. propositions

 The firstexample revisited

 The second example revisited

 The final version

 A clarification

 Concluding remarks

 Exercises

PART V REDUNDANCY

Chapter 15 We Need More Science

 A little history

 Database design is predicate design

 Example 1

 Example 2

 Example 3

 Example 4

 Example 5

 Example 6

 Example 7

 Example 8

 Example 9

 Example 10

 Example 11

 Example 12

 Managing redundancy

 Refining the definition

 Concluding remarks

 Exercises

 APPENDIXES

Appendix A Primary Keys Are Nice but Not Essential

 Arguments in favor of the PK:AK distinction

 Relvars with more than one key

 The invoices and shipments example

 One primary key per entity type?

 The applicants and employees example

 Concluding remarks

Appendix B Redundancy Revisited

Appendix C Historical Notes

Appendix D Answers to Exercises

 Chapter 1

 Chapter 2

 Chapter 3

 Chapter 4

 Chapter 5

 Chapter 6

 Chapter 7

 Chapter 8

 Chapter 9

 Chapter 10

 Chapter 11

 Chapter 12

 Chapter 13

 Chapter 14

 Chapter 15

 Index

标签
缩略图
书名 数据库设计与关系理论(影印版)
副书名
原作名
作者 (英)戴特
译者
编者
绘者
出版社 东南大学出版社
商品编码(ISBN) 9787564138905
开本 16开
页数 260
版次 1
装订 平装
字数 338
出版时间 2013-01-01
首版时间 2013-01-01
印刷时间 2013-01-01
正文语种
读者对象 青年(14-20岁),研究人员,普通成人
适用范围
发行范围 公开发行
发行模式 实体书
首发网站
连载网址
图书大类
图书小类
重量 0.42
CIP核字
中图分类号 TP311.13
丛书名
印张 17.25
印次 1
出版地 江苏
232
178
13
整理
媒质 图书
用纸 普通纸
是否注音
影印版本 原版
出版商国别 CN
是否套装 单册
著作权合同登记号 图字10-2012-158
版权提供者 O'Reilly Media,Inc.
定价
印数
出品方
作品荣誉
主角
配角
其他角色
一句话简介
立意
作品视角
所属系列
文章进度
内容简介
作者简介
目录
文摘
安全警示 适度休息有益身心健康,请勿长期沉迷于阅读小说。
随便看

 

兰台网图书档案馆全面收录古今中外各种图书,详细介绍图书的基本信息及目录、摘要等图书资料。

 

Copyright © 2004-2025 xlantai.com All Rights Reserved
更新时间:2025/5/12 10:17:20